Morson Human Resources Limited is seeking an experienced CNC Setter/Operator to join their manufacturing team in Crewkerne, Somerset. This hands-on role involves operating CNC sliding head machines and grinders, managing machining processes from setup through to inspection.

The ideal candidate will have proven experience in setting and operating CNC machines, with a strong understanding of quality standards and machining tolerances. The role offers long-term stability and opportunities for development.
